Very quick and to the point. Was able to be very comfortable amongst the interviewer wasn't an issue and it's a very open and friendly work staff to look forward to dealing with. They asked very simple, character based questions that required little thought to answer. The process is quick as to how it actually takes from interview to training. It took one day to get a call for interview, I was filling the background info out by the night and now that it's after Black Friday, I'll be able to start training and make the last holiday rush of Christmas.

Over the phone quick easy. One with the TD and the current owner of the system, where we talked through the current state of affairs and what I'd do to fix it.
The second was with the Director of HR and the President, where we just had a conversation about values, culture, and what I was like as a person. They asked what my salary expectations were, I gave them my dream number.
